Janaprith Fernando
Janaprith Salinda Fernando (Sinhala: ජනප්රිත් සාලින්ද ප්රනාන්දු; 23 September 1967 in Ratmalana) of Colombo, Sri Lanka, served as the Chief Commissioner of the Sri Lanka Scout Association until January 2026, and as the President of the Colombo Law Society. He was the first Sri Lankan to be elected as a volunteer member of the Asia-Pacific Regional Scout Committee of the World Organization of the Scout Movement (WOSM) to serve from 2012 to 2018. He was also the first and only Sri Lankan to have served in the World Scout Committee, the World Organization of the Scout Movement's highest governing body. Fernando was elected for a four year term to this body in August 2017 by the 41st World Scout Conference, held in Baku, Azerbaijan.Fernando graduated from S. Thomas' College, Mount Lavinia, studied at the Sri Lanka Law College where he was the President of the Law Students' Union in 1990, and is practicing as an attorney, representing many leading Business Enterprises, Governmental, Non -Governmental, INGOs and Mercantile Sector Organisations in Sri Lanka, including the Colombo Lotus Tower.
Janaprith serves in a number other roles including as the Chairman of Bookbridge Sri Lanka, President of the Centre for Leadership and Talent Development and has served in a number of boards of private and public institutions in Sri Lanka. Provided by Wikipedia
